Output 13bbfef77920fd70663a12812a6e806e030af2fe7a70a4ade1fc3c39adaabbfb:19

value
684290735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b2217c1ac77b11231e170bee0f1dfda94e293c OP_EQUAL
address
3Cbuj7iGVS2biRwvoq1MCvefh4Y92crvhf
transaction
13bbfef77920fd70663a12812a6e806e030af2fe7a70a4ade1fc3c39adaabbfb
spent
true